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Milwaukee County
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Milwaukee County?
Actualmente hay 3598 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Milwaukee County, WI con precios que van desde $486 hasta $36,000. También hay 356 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Milwaukee County que van desde $625 hasta $3,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Milwaukee County?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Milwaukee County oscilan entre $625 hasta $3,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,419.
